Output 6981866c4e03ccd3836fb9c856a930a1a997024b45580ddc12a5b6d28088fca7: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5a22a1e878d0d3add99610b81beba8a610e168 OP_EQUAL
address
3PWbQ6nGj527dLvQjZ9QqHQoaX4LgzCzZL
transaction
6981866c4e03ccd3836fb9c856a930a1a997024b45580ddc12a5b6d28088fca7
spent
true